There are several methods for installing windows, each appropriate for various situations:
Full Frame Installation: This technique includes removing the whole window system, consisting of the frame, and changing it with a brand-new window. This is ideal for homes with comprehensive concerns around the window area, such as rot or decay.
Retrofit Installation: Known as insert installation, this method replaces the window while leaving the existing frame intact. It's a popular option when the existing frame is in excellent condition, minimizing costs.
Window Replacement: This includes getting rid of the old Glazing Near Me system and replacing it with a brand-new one. It's efficient for single and double-hung windows that still have their frames undamaged however require new glass.
New Construction Installation: Used mainly for new structures, this technique involves building-in the windows as part of the general structure, making sure a tight seal and correct fit right from the start.

A successful window installation needs cautious planning and execution. Below is a step-by-step guide that lays out the key stages.
Preparation PhasePick Your Windows: Select windows ideal for your environment and budget. Consider energy-efficient models which can conserve long-term expenses.Procedure the Opening: Accurately measure the width and height of the existing window. It's important to get accurate measurements to prevent installation concerns later.Installation PhaseGet Rid Of Old Windows: Carefully eliminate the existing window. For full-frame setups, secure the frame and any surrounding devices.Inspect the Rough Opening: Check for any damage to the structure that requires repair before placing the new window.Install New Window: Place the brand-new window into the rough opening, guaranteeing it is level and plumb. Secure it in location with shims.Seal and Insulate: Add insulation around the window frame, and apply caulking or foam sealant to prevent air leakages.Finish with Trim: After the window is safely set up, location exterior and interior trim to complete the appearance.Post-Installation PhaseTidy the Area: Clean up any debris or product packaging materials from the installation website.Check Operation: Ensure that the window opens and closes smoothly.Last Inspection: Inspect for any gaps or fractures that need sealing.Upkeep TipsFrequently clean window tracks and frames to avoid buildup that might hinder operation.Inspect caulking and seals annually to guarantee they remain undamaged.Typical Challenges in Window Installation

Q: How long does it require to set up new windows?A: On average, a professional installation team can install a standard-sized window in about 30 to 45 minutes. More comprehensive installations, such as complete frame, may take longer.
Q: How often should windows be replaced?A: On average, windows ought to be examined every 20 to 25 years. However, this can vary based on window quality, upkeep, and external environmental conditions.
Q: Can I set up windows myself?A: While experienced DIYers might set up windows themselves, it is often suggested to employ professionals to guarantee correct installation and warranty security.
Q: What are energy-efficient windows?A: Energy-efficient windows are developed to decrease heat loss and enhance insulation. They typically have low-emissivity (Low-E) finishes and argon gas fills between glass panes.
